What is a Certified Window Installer?
Certified window installers are specialists who have gone through specific training and accreditation processes that verify their skills and understanding associated to the installation of doors and windows. They stick to market requirements, making sure that installations are done correctly, safely, and in compliance with pertinent guidelines. Here are some key elements of their accreditations:
Training Programs: Certified installers usually total training programs that cover various aspects of window installation, including structural stability, safety requirements, and energy effectiveness.Official Certification: After finishing training, they get certification from acknowledged market organizations or makers, which often requires passing an examination.Continuing Education: Many certification bodies need ongoing education to stay updated on technological developments and existing best practices within the market.Why Choose Certified Window Installers?
Picking certified window installers offers homeowners a wide variety of advantages that can significantly impact the total outcome of their projects. Below are some reasons working with certified professionals is a smart decision:
1. Quality control
Certified installers possess the skills and understanding needed to perform top quality setups. They understand the intricacies of window placement, sealing, and insulation, which is crucial for preventing air and water leaks. This attention to detail makes sure that windows carry out efficiently and contribute to energy effectiveness.
2. Guarantee Protection
Many window manufacturers partner with certified installers. This implies that if a window is set up by a certified professional, it typically comes with a separate warranty that covers installation concerns. If non-certified installers do the installation, guarantees may be voided, leaving house owners accountable for any repair work.
3. Regulative Compliance
Certified window installers recognize with local building codes and policies. They make sure that all installations comply with these laws, assisting property owners avoid expensive fines and legal difficulties due to non-compliance.
4. Boosted Energy Efficiency
Appropriate installation is important for window performance. Certified installers are trained to minimize air leakages, install energy-efficient windows correctly, and enhance insulation. This can cause decreased energy expenses and an enhanced environmental footprint.
5. Security Considerations
Installing windows can position safety risks, specifically when operating at heights or handling heavy materials. Certified installers are trained in security protocols, decreasing the danger of mishaps and injuries throughout the installation procedure.

What credentials should I look for in a certified window installer?
Property owners should search for certifications from acknowledged companies, together with evidence of insurance coverage, and appropriate experience in window setups.
2. How do I know if my window installers are certified?
You can ask the installers straight for evidence of their certifications or go to the certification company's site for a list of certified professionals.
3. What makes installation by certified experts worth the additional cost?
The knowledge of certified installers can avoid concerns associated with incorrect installation, which may lead to greater expenses in repairs, inefficiency, and guarantee voids in the long run.
4. Are all window installation companies certified?
No, not all window installation companies employ certified installers. It's important to inquire clearly about certifications before working with.
5. Can I install windows myself if I have basic handyman skills?
While some house owners have actually successfully installed windows themselves, it's suggested to hire certified specialists to ensure safety and compliance with regulations.
